Lebec, June 30, 2025 -

A traffic collision involving two vehicles occurred today on Interstate 5 North in Lebec, CA, prompting a significant emergency response. The incident, which took place around 3:33 PM, involved a black 2025 Volkswagen Jetta and a white Hyundai Palisade. Emergency units were dispatched to the scene to manage traffic and secure the area, ensuring safety for all motorists.

While specific details regarding lane closures were not provided, the emergency response team worked diligently to minimize traffic disruption. A tow truck was called to assist with the removal of the vehicles involved in the collision, which is essential for preventing further delays and maintaining traffic flow on this busy highway.

Motorists traveling on Interstate 5 North should remain cautious and expect potential delays as the situation is managed. The California Highway Patrol is overseeing the incident to ensure that traffic can resume smoothly once the vehicles are cleared from the roadway.
